Revenue Growth: Deliveroo reported a fourth-quarter revenue increase to 545 million pounds, up from 523 million pounds the previous year, despite missing analyst expectations of 547 million pounds.
Earnings Expectations: The company raised its full-year adjusted earnings expectations due to accelerated gross transaction value growth in key markets.
